DrivePool needs Reset after restart, Windows 11 latest


PetarK

Question

I've been using DrivePool for almost 3 years with no issues at all. This started a week ago. After a PC restart the DrivePool is gone. There are no HDDs I can add. The app simply does not see any drives available. The solution I've found that works is I need to add drive letters to my 2 hard drives, reset DrivePool, remove drive letters and add a new drive letter to the DrivePool. This is extremely annoying. Does anyone have any info on this?
